


Überlastung in Computersystemen und Netzwerken verstehen
Überlastung bezieht sich auf eine Situation, in der ein System oder Netzwerk nicht in der Lage ist, die empfangene Menge an Datenverkehr oder Daten zu verarbeiten. Dies kann verschiedene Gründe haben, beispielsweise ein plötzlicher Anstieg der Nutzerzahl oder die gleichzeitige Übertragung gro+er Datenmengen. Wenn ein System überlastet ist, kann es langsam werden oder nicht mehr reagieren und sogar abstürzen oder vollständig ausfallen.
Es gibt verschiedene Arten von Überlastung, die in Computersystemen und Netzwerken auftreten können, darunter:
1. CPU-Überlastung: Dies tritt auf, wenn die Zentraleinheit (CPU) nicht in der Lage ist, die Menge an Arbeit zu bewältigen, die von ihr verlangt wird. Dies kann passieren, wenn zu viele Prozesse gleichzeitig ausgeführt werden oder wenn ein einzelner Prozess zu viele CPU-Ressourcen verbraucht.
2. Speicherüberlastung: Dies tritt auf, wenn der Speicher des Systems nicht alle Daten speichern kann, die es verarbeiten muss. Dies kann passieren, wenn zu viele Anwendungen gleichzeitig ausgeführt werden oder wenn eine einzelne Anwendung zu viel Speicher beansprucht.
3. Netzwerküberlastung: Dies tritt auf, wenn das Netzwerk nicht in der Lage ist, die Menge an Datenverkehr zu verarbeiten, die es empfängt. Dies kann passieren, wenn zu viele Benutzer gleichzeitig auf das Netzwerk zugreifen oder wenn ein einzelner Benutzer zu viele Daten überträgt.
4. Festplattenüberlastung: Dies tritt auf, wenn der Festplattenspeicher des Systems nicht alle Daten speichern kann, die es speichern muss. Dies kann passieren, wenn zu viele Dateien oder Anwendungen auf dem System installiert sind oder wenn eine einzelne Datei oder Anwendung zu gro+ ist.
Um eine Überlastung von Computersystemen und Netzwerken zu verhindern, ist es wichtig, Ressourcen wie CPU, Speicher und Netzwerk sorgfältig zu verwalten Bandbreite und Speicherplatz. Dies kann Techniken umfassen wie:
1. Lastausgleich: Hierbei werden Arbeitslasten auf mehrere Server oder Prozesse verteilt, um zu verhindern, dass ein Server oder Prozess überlastet wird.
2. Ressourcenzuweisung: Dabei werden bestimmte Ressourcenmengen (z. B. CPU, Speicher und Netzwerkbandbreite) verschiedenen Anwendungen oder Benutzern zugewiesen, um sicherzustellen, dass keine Anwendung oder kein Benutzer zu viele Ressourcen verbraucht.
3. Caching: Dies beinhaltet das Speichern häufig aufgerufener Daten im Speicher oder auf der Festplatte, um die Datenmenge zu reduzieren, die übertragen oder verarbeitet werden muss.
4. Content Delivery Networks (CDNs): Hierbei handelt es sich um Servernetzwerke, die über verschiedene geografische Standorte verteilt sind, um einen schnelleren und zuverlässigeren Zugriff auf Inhalte zu ermöglichen.
5. Cloud Computing: Dabei wird eine cloudbasierte Infrastruktur genutzt, um skalierbaren und bedarfsgesteuerten Zugriff auf Ressourcen wie CPU, Arbeitsspeicher und Speicher bereitzustellen.



